A 16-day-old infant is being treated in the Covid Intensive Care Unit of the General Hospital of Chania after being diagnosed with coronavirus. According to zarpanews.gr, the baby boy was born in a private clinic and, after being discharged, developed serious symptoms that led to his admission to the ICU.

The director of the Chania Hospital, Giorgos Beas, told Creta24 that the infant's health condition is stable. Additionally, a 5-year-old girl is being treated in the pediatric Covid clinic.

Professor of Pulmonology Stelios Loukidis stated on ERT that there is an increase in coronavirus cases, but there is no cause for concern. He noted that the increase mainly concerns people with underlying diseases or older age groups. He advised caution, especially in contact with vulnerable people, and the use of simple tests in case of mild symptoms.

Mr. Loukidis mentioned that the approvals of antiviral drugs have increased, but remain at lower levels compared to previous years.
